Canada Confirms Execution of Four Canadians by China

Canada’s Foreign Minister Mélanie Joly announced that China executed four Canadians recently, a rare occurrence for Western individuals. Both Joly and former Prime Minister Justin Trudeau had previously sought clemency concerning the drug-related charges against these dual citizens.
